Summary

CVE-2015-10040 is a medium-severity Injection (CWE-74) vulnerability in Gitlearn Project Gitlearn. Its CVSS base score is 5.4 (Medium).

Operationally, ranked at the 47.1th percentile by exploit likelihood (below the median); it is not currently listed in the CISA KEV catalog; a public proof-of-concept is referenced.
